In that one particular version of the logo. Here's an article from 2005 if you don't believe me on their intention for Living: http://www.broadcastnow.co.uk/sex-appeal/1029330.article (copy in to Google to read).

Quote:
Similarly, the women-focused Living TV is now looking to appeal more to men. "We are a female-skewing channel, we have a feminine sensibility," says Living TV director of television Richard Woolfe, "but we absolutely need men to make the channel work. Men used to say Living TV is not for me, but now it's like men have come out of the closet to watch Living TV because we've shifted the brand." Of course, it's not just the branding - the programmes have had to change, too. While the average skew for the channel was typically 60-40 in favour of female viewers, there are now more programmes, such as CSI, that will have a 50/50 balance.


This same Richard Woolfe would later hold Stuart Murphy's job at Sky 1 - before Murphy himself axed basically everything he'd done.
